    Designed for children to play together

    Do children enter any personal information?

    No. Acorn Chess uses automatically generated player names, so children don't need to provide their name, email address or other personal information to play online.

    Can players send messages or share content?

    No. Acorn Chess does not provide chat, messaging, image sharing or other social features between players.

    Who can my child play against?

    Children can only play other members of their private groups, such as friends, classmates or chess club members. Even automatic matchmaking only finds opponents from within those groups.

    Does Acorn Chess still work offline?

    Yes. Acorn Chess can still be used offline for lessons, mini-games and games against the built-in chess engine.
